All that said, be clear in identifying the kinds of children you are willing to take, but be careful not to be so picky that you never get called. In many private adoptions, the birth mom will review "lifebooks" from several prospective adoptive parents that meet her specific criteria. Sadly your age, attractiveness, and ethnicity will impact her choices, as will the style of your presentation and the photos you select. After passing that hurdle, you will get an opportunity to have a face to face with her, and hopefully establish some positive chemistry. We have many friends and family members who have adopted. Fees have ranged from $7,500 to $60,000, with the mean somewhere north of $25,000. I will be happy to answer any questions you may have, and good luck in your search.
